Some info: The only way to change the audio volume, is by changing it's waveform. As the mp3 files do not contain a pure waveform, it is impossible to change an mp3's volume without first converting it to a wave file and afterwards recompressing it to mp3. Thus, when saving an mp3 with changed volume you have to be carefull with the output bitrate. Even the progs that do not give you a bitrate option do have an internal encoder with probably a fixed bitrate.
